Hops Festival Beer Stein- October 1
Love fresh-hop beer? There will be over 25 breweries at Hood River Hops Fest this  year, a kids' zone and art and food vendors. Right in downtown Hood River between 5th & 7th and Cascade & Columbia streets. Admission ($6) includes a commemorative stein and tasting tokens are only $1. We'll see you there!
Harvest Festival - October 14-16Apples
How do you carve an 800lb pumpkin? We're not sure, but we're going to find out at this year's Harvest Festival. October 14-16 at the Hood River waterfront is this year's art, food, fresh-produce, carriage-ride, entertainment and all things Harvest extravaganza. Don't forget Friday is half-price for seniors (65+), kids 12 and under get in free all weekend, and of course, the parking is FREE!
